package android.bluetooth;
import android.bluetooth.IBluetoothCallback;
import android.bluetooth.IBluetoothStateChangeCallback;
import android.bluetooth.BluetoothActivityEnergyInfo;
import android.bluetooth.BluetoothDevice;
import android.os.ParcelUuid;
import android.os.ParcelFileDescriptor;
/**
* System private API for talking with the Bluetooth service.
*
* {@hide}
*/
interface IBluetooth
{
boolean isEnabled();
int getState();
boolean enable();
boolean enableNoAutoConnect();
boolean disable();
String getAddress();
ParcelUuid[] getUuids();
boolean setName(in String name);
String getName();
int getScanMode();
boolean setScanMode(int mode, int duration);
int getDiscoverableTimeout();
boolean setDiscoverableTimeout(int timeout);
boolean startDiscovery();
boolean cancelDiscovery();
boolean isDiscovering();
int getAdapterConnectionState();
int getProfileConnectionState(int profile);
BluetoothDevice[] getBondedDevices();
boolean createBond(in BluetoothDevice device, in int transport);
boolean cancelBondProcess(in BluetoothDevice device);
boolean removeBond(in BluetoothDevice device);
int getBondState(in BluetoothDevice device);
boolean isConnected(in BluetoothDevice device);
String getRemoteName(in BluetoothDevice device);
int getRemoteType(in BluetoothDevice device);
String getRemoteAlias(in BluetoothDevice device);
boolean setRemoteAlias(in BluetoothDevice device, in String name);
int getRemoteClass(in BluetoothDevice device);
ParcelUuid[] getRemoteUuids(in BluetoothDevice device);
boolean fetchRemoteUuids(in BluetoothDevice device);
boolean fetchRemoteMasInstances(in BluetoothDevice device);
boolean setPin(in BluetoothDevice device, boolean accept, int len, in byte[] pinCode);
boolean setPasskey(in BluetoothDevice device, boolean accept, int len, in byte[]
passkey);
boolean setPairingConfirmation(in BluetoothDevice device, boolean accept);
int getPhonebookAccessPermission(in BluetoothDevice device);
boolean setPhonebookAccessPermission(in BluetoothDevice device, int value);
int getMessageAccessPermission(in BluetoothDevice device);
boolean setMessageAccessPermission(in BluetoothDevice device, int value);
void sendConnectionStateChange(in BluetoothDevice device, int profile, int state, int prevState);
void registerCallback(in IBluetoothCallback callback);
void unregisterCallback(in IBluetoothCallback callback);
// For Socket
ParcelFileDescriptor connectSocket(in BluetoothDevice device, int type, in ParcelUuid uuid, int port, int flag);
ParcelFileDescriptor createSocketChannel(int type, in String serviceName, in ParcelUuid uuid, int port, int flag);
boolean configHciSnoopLog(boolean enable);
boolean isMultiAdvertisementSupported();
boolean isOffloadedFilteringSupported();
boolean isOffloadedScanBatchingSupported();
boolean isActivityAndEnergyReportingSupported();
void getActivityEnergyInfoFromController();
BluetoothActivityEnergyInfo reportActivityInfo();
}
